DOGE was created as a lighthearted alternative to traditional cryptocurrencies. It is based on the famous "Doge" Internet meme and features a Shiba Inu on its logo. Elon Musk says DOGE is his favorite cryptocurrency.

Built for fast, zero-fee USDT payments and customizable gas tokens, it enables borderless, permissionless access to financial services. With its global payments network and integrated products, Plasma is establishing itself as the native chain for stablecoin transactions.
